EDP has been distinguished, for sixth consecutive year, as one of the most ethic companies in the world. In the list of Most Ethic Companies in the World 2017, the Ethisphere Institute recognizes 124 companies from 19 countries.

The Ethisphere Institute acknowledges the companies that lead with integrity and show the alignment of their management practice with principles and ethic commitments. Using their own model, the Ethisphere Institute evaluates the maturity and performance of the management systems in the field of ethic and compliance.

Apart from recognizing the adoption of good performances in sustainability and ethic in its business areas and in its whole value chain, this international distinction shows Group EDP’s commitment to reinforce both the ethic culture and the trust relations with its interest groups.

 

About the Ethisphere Institute

The Ethisphere Institute is an international organization, that works on the development of better performances in the entrepreneurial ethic, social responsibility and sustainability. For eleven years it has been evaluating companies, at a global level, and acknowledges their performance in different areas of entrepreneurial management.

EDP

EDP is an energy group, leader in international value creation, innovation and sustainability. It is part of the Dow Jones Sustainability Indexes (World and STOXX), and it is moreover leader in world renewable energy.

In Spain, EDP is a model company in the energy market, present in the generation, distribution and commercialization of electric energy, natural gas and services, in which more than 3 million people already trust.

EDP is leader in gas in Cantabria, Murcia and the Basque Country, as well as in Asturias, where it is also model electric operator.
